[01/21] image*.bbclass, kernel*.bbclass: create version-less artifacts and versioned hard links

* instead of versioned artifacts and version-less symlinks

* We used to create the actual artifact files with some version
  in the filename and then created symlink without any version
  which was updated to point to the latest one created.
  In some scenarios it's useful to create all artifacts - typically
  rootfs and kernel images with the same version - like release
  build even when the kernel itself wasn't modified since the
  previous release.

  If we include the release version in the regular _NAME variables
  then we'll need to re-run do_deploy and do_image which will cause
  kernel to be rebuilt and image to be re-created even when the
  only change since last build was the version number.

  With this change we can re-use kernel and image from sstate when
  nothing was changed and run only very fast do_deploy_links task
  which just adds another hard link to existing artifact from
  sstate.

* move IMAGE_VERSION_SUFFIX from _NAME variables to _LINK_NAME
  that way e.g. kernel.do_deploy can be reused from sstate to
  provide "version-less" artifacts and then very fast
  do_deploy_links task just adds links with consistent suffixes
  (by default the version from the recipe but could be easily set
  to e.g. some release name when building some products).
* create hard links instead of symlinks, so that whatever version
  the filename says is really there
* some IMAGE_FSTYPES might need the "version-less" IMAGE_NAME file
  to be removed first or they might either append or update the
  content of the image instead of creating new image file from
  scratch - I have seen this only with one proprietary format we
  generate with our own tool, so hopefully this isn't very common
* this is basically the mechanism are using in webOS with
  WEBOS_IMAGE_NAME_SUFFIX which is for official builds set from
  jenkins job and then all artifacts (images as well as corresponding
  kernel files) have the same version string)

* without this, you can still easily set the variables to contain
  the version from jenkins job (excluded from sstate signature like
  DATETIME currently is to prevent rebuilding it everytime even when
  the content didn't change) but then when kernel is reused from sstate
  you can have version 1.0 used on kernel artifacts and 2.0 on image
  artifacts.

* if you don't exclude the version string with vardepsexclude, then
  you get the right version in the filenames but for cost of
  re-executing do_deploy every single time, which with rm_work will
  cause all kernel tasks to be re-executed (together with everything
  which depends on it like external modules etc).

* drop ${PKGE}-${PKGV}-${PR} from kernel artifacts names (this is the
  latest build) and add it only in hardlinks created in do_deploy_links
  so that we can use PKGR there again (because these links are generally
  used only by human operators and they don't have their own TASKHASH or
  the IMAGE_VERSION_SUFFIX might be set to some release name which they
  do understand

* this allows to drop package_get_auto_pr from kernel do_deploy as well,
  leaving only 2 EXTENDPRAUTO bumps for each kernel build (do_package
  and do_deploy_links, unfortunatelly these will still have different
  value, so if you're looking for the exact kernel image in deploy
  directory based on kernel image package version seen on the device the
  EXTENDPRAUTO part of PR will be different).
